In tragic news, the brother of Miguel Tejada died in a motorcycle accident in the Dominican Republic. Freddy Manuel Tejada, 37-years old, was killed when his motorcycle was struck by an SUV in the city of Bani.
The Houston Astros acquired Tejada from the Baltimore Orioles this offseason and he’s expected to be the team’s everyday starting shortstop. Tejada, who is a former MVP in the American League, said he plans to honor his brother by continuing to play winter baseball in their home country of the Dominican Republic.
“I will continue playing ball with the Eagles as long as I can. This is the best tribute I can give to Freddy,” Tejada said.
